A brand new collection of never before published short stories of the great Egyptian writer, Naguib Mahfouz. These stories were discovered in a box of papers delivered to the editor by Mahfouz's daughter, Umm Kuthum. Mahfouz won the1988 Nobel Prize for Literature. The book includes facsimiles of the original pages in the author's handwriting.
